What is rho in options?
Understand how rho estimates an option's sensitivity to interest rates and when the effect matters more

Direct answer
Rho estimates how much an option's theoretical value may change for a one-percentage-point change in interest rates, with other pricing inputs held constant. Long calls generally have positive rho and long puts generally have negative rho. The effect is usually more meaningful for longer-dated options, while short-dated contracts may be dominated by stock movement, time decay, and implied volatility
Read rho in percentage points
If a call has rho of 0.12, a model may estimate about a twelve-cent increase when the relevant rate rises by one percentage point, not by one percent of its current level. The estimate reverses for a comparable rate decline when the local relationship is similar
Rates affect the timing value of cash
Option models account for the cost of carrying the underlying and the present value of the strike. Higher rates generally support call values and weigh on put values under otherwise identical assumptions, though dividends and product terms also matter
Rho can be small without being irrelevant
For a near-term equity option, delta, gamma, theta, or vega may explain more of a daily price move. Rho becomes easier to notice in long-dated contracts or when the assumed rate path changes materially
Common questions
Does a rate increase guarantee calls will rise?
No. Positive call rho isolates the rate input. A falling stock, lower implied volatility, time decay, or market quotes can more than offset that modeled effect
Which options have the most rho exposure?
Longer-dated options generally have more rate sensitivity because the financing and present-value effects operate over a longer period
